Located in the heart of Beijing, the Temple of Heaven attracts countless tourists with its magnificent architecture and profound cultural heritage. This place of worship from the Ming and Qing dynasties is not only where ancient Chinese emperors prayed to the gods for a good harvest, but also an excellent place for modern people to understand Chinese history and culture.
✨Must-see attractions✨
1. Circular Mound Altar: This is the core of the Temple of Heaven. The circular altar symbolizes the sky, and the square fences around it represent the earth. Standing on the altar, you can feel the solemn atmosphere of the ancient sacrificial ceremony.
2. Hall of Prayer for Good Harvests: This three-eaved blue-roofed building is brightly colored and has a strong visual impact. Every year during the winter solstice, the emperor would pray here for a good harvest in the coming year, making this place an important symbol of ancient Chinese culture.
3. Imperial Vault of Heaven: This is another important building in the Temple of Heaven. It houses an altar dedicated to the gods, which makes people feel awe.
Travel Tips
⌛️Best time to visit: It is recommended to choose morning or evening, when there are relatively fewer tourists and you can enjoy the attractions more calmly.
👟Dress comfortably: The Temple of Heaven is quite large, so wearing comfortable shoes will allow you to stroll around freely.
📖Cultural experience: If you have the opportunity, take part in local Tai Chi classes or folk performances to add interest to your trip.
